What can I use instead of a curling iron?

Fabric curlers To make them, cut one-inch wide strips of fabric (the cotton from an old T-shirt will work like a charm), and roll one-inch sections of hair around the strip until your reach the root of your hair. Finish off the makeshift roller by tying the loose ends of fabric into a knot.

How can I curl my short hair in 5 minutes without heat?

Here is how:

  1. Wash your hair and allow it to dry a little.
  2. Put the headband on your head so the front part is in the middle of your forehead.
  3. Separate your hair into as many sections as you wish and wrap each one of them around the headband.
  4. Leave the hair alone for at least 5 minutes (the longer the better).

What’s the best way to get loose curls without heat?

1Braid Your Hair “One of the easiest ways to get loose waves without heat is to braid your hair at night and sleep with it in,” Fitzsimon says. That way, when you wake up in the morning, all you have to do is undo the braids and apply a smoothing hair oil to tame any frizz.
